Gene

Rap2a

Species
Rattus norvegicus
Symbol
Rap2a
Name
RAP2A, member of RAS oncogene family
Synonyms
  • rap2A-like protein
  • RAS related protein 2a
Biotype
protein coding gene
Automated Description
Predicted to enable GTPase activity; guanyl ribonucleotide binding activity; and magnesium ion binding activity. Predicted to be involved in several processes, including Rap protein signal transduction; microvillus assembly; and regulation of dendrite morphogenesis. Predicted to act upstream of or within establishment of protein localization and positive regulation of protein autophosphorylation. Is active in synaptic membrane. Orthologous to human RAP2A (RAP2A, member of RAS oncogene family).
